Infections in lower extremity vascular grafts

Summary
Managing infrainguinal graft infections requires a clinical approach, not rigid guidelines. Key principles guide selective management, prioritizing graft preservation or excision based on infection severity and graft type.

Background:
- Infrainguinal graft infections pose significant challenges in vascular surgery.
- Standardized guidelines for managing these infections are lacking, necessitating a rational, patient-specific approach.
Purpose of the Study:
- To outline fundamental principles for the selective management of infrainguinal graft infections.
- To provide a framework for decision-making regarding graft preservation versus excision.
Main Methods:
- Review of clinical principles for managing infrainguinal graft infections.
- Analysis of factors influencing graft preservation (patency, sepsis) versus mandatory excision (thrombosis, hemorrhage, sepsis).
- Consideration of graft material (vein, PTFE, Dacron) and specific pathogens (e.g., Pseudomonas aeruginosa).
Main Results:
- Graft preservation is feasible for patent, intact grafts in non-septic patients, applicable to vein and PTFE but not Dacron grafts.
- Graft excision is mandatory for thrombosed, hemorrhaging, or systemically septic patients.
- Delayed hemorrhage or persistent sepsis after attempted preservation indicates failure and necessitates excision.
Conclusions:
- Selective management based on clinical assessment is crucial for infrainguinal graft infections.
- Revascularization strategies should consider extra-anatomic reconstruction to bypass infected areas.
- Treatment decisions must balance graft salvage with patient safety, especially in severe infections.
